Harbhajan Singh to play the Legends Cricket League along with other former veterans

Harbhajan Singh, former Indian off-spinner, will return to the cricket field in September when he plays in the second season of the Legends League Cricket (LLC).

In addition to former Australian quick Brett Lee, former Indian opener Virender Sehwag, Irfan Pathan, Yusuf Pathan, spin great Muttiah Muralitharan, and former England captain Eoin Morgan, Harbhajan will now join the ranks of previous Indian openers.
110 former international cricket players will play on four teams in the LLC’s second season.

“It makes me feel super charged to be back on the ground and play with the global legends of the game. I am looking forward to September eagerly,” Harbhajan said.

Along with Harbhajan, former Bangladesh captain Mashrafe Mortaza has also declared his attendance at the next LLC.
Lendl Simmons and Denesh Ramdin, two former West Indies cricketers, have entered the league’s player draught for the 2018 season.
Former cricket players from India, Pakistan, Sri Lanka, Australia, and England were divided into three teams to represent India, Asia, and the rest of the world in the tournament’s debut year.
